CRITICAL FIRE WEATHER CONDITIONS SATURDAY
- Warm temperatures near 60 degrees, very low relative humidity values between 10 to 20 percent, southwest winds gusting to 35 to 45 mph, and dry fuels will lead to critical fire weather conditions across central and southern Minnesota on Saturday.
-
AFFECTED AREA: Portions of south central, southwest, and west central Minnesota.
-
TIMING: From 10 AM to 9 PM CDT Saturday.
-
WINDS: Southwest winds 25 to 35 mph with gusts up to 45 mph.
-
RELATIVE HUMIDITY: Around 15 percent.
-
IMPACTS: Any fires that develop will spread rapidly. Outdoor burning is not recommended.
